MERITORIOUS GRANT GROWS BIGGER

Again in 2007, West Coast Active Riders will award a grant comprised of showing and stabling fees at west coast horse shows to two deserving young riders. Awarded on the basis of athletic and academic merit as well as financial need, these grants enable up-and-coming riders who are dedicated to their education and the sport of show jumping the opportunity to compete at horse shows they may otherwise not have attended. 

WCAR is grateful for the generosity of the following horse show managers who make this grant possible: Dale Harvey of West Palms Communications, Robert Ridland and RJ Brandes at Oaks Blenheim, Larry & Marnye Langer of Equestrian Sports, Inc., Adrian Ward of Pickwick Equestrian and Tim Postel at Pebble Beach Equestrian Center. Trial 7 is mandatory. Scores tabulated via judges card from each class. BEST 4 out of 7 scores to count.

Applications Available: Jan 12th, 2007 (upon approval from show managers)
Applications Due: March 12th, 2007
Application Fee: $250 per horse & rider

An Awards Presentation announcing the 2007 Spruce Teams will be held at Showpark Ranch and Coast (May 9 - 13) after Classics are complete. Each Team Member (16 total) will receive gifts & a grant towards a $1,500 stipend. Examples of past gifts include hunt coats, gloves, WCAR merchandise and a team dinner at Spruce.

A LOOK BACK & A LEAP FORWARD

What a year we’ve had… beginning with a fantastic sold out Casino Night at La Quinta to picking five teams, four for Spruce and one for Europe, followed by a deliciously successful 1st Annual Cook-Off, leading to a bounty of victories in countries from Canada to France – including:

  • Spruce Meadows Prix de Nations
    • The 1.10 Team took 2nd place after numerous clean rounds led the team to a jump off.  Chef: Susan Artes
    • The 1.20 Team again took a close 2nd place!  Chef: Will Simpson
    • The 1.30 Team ended with a very respectable 6th place finish after facing a very difficult course. Chef: Hap Hansen
    • The 1.40 Team took over the 3rd place position. They stayed strong all the way with a tough track and even tougher competition. Chef: Joie Gatlin

THANK YOU TAMMY CHIPKO FOR ALL YOUR HARD WORK! 

  • WCAR European Team
    • Joie Gatlin: Leading lady rider – Royan, France
    • Francie Steinwedell-Carvin: 2nd in the Grand Prix de la Ville de Royan
    • Jenni Martin: 5th in the Small Grand Prix – Royan, France
    • Team: 4th in a difficult Nations Cup – Gijon, Spain
    • And a handful of other ribbons throughout the tour
